In September, I went to Milan to find out what new is being released and followed in the shoes. 

3 days of exposure, meaning endless walking and fatigue.

Untitled 138

The Micam exhibition was really very interesting. I found out the next summer shoes and some last-minute winter that give the stigma of the next winter 2019-20.
I visited as a blogger, very interesting and private pavilions of great exhibitors, I attended 2 outstanding fashion shows and talk of 3 US bloggers.

In the afternoon, I had to photograph the shop's windows, wanting to gather all the material I needed for my job and for the posts I would share with you.

Do you know how much I love my high-heeled shoes, it's really my favourite but those conditions this would be painful.

My choices for those 3 days were between sneakers and shock-boots. Some similar booties I had worn on my previous trip in February, and it was an excellent choice.

IMG 7042

So I chose a white shock-boot with red and black stripes at the top line in white soles.
I had no difficulty to combine them at all. The white colour is undoubtedly one of the strongest trends of this winter, especially in booties.

So I combined it with a short jeans pants and a black shirt with neon colours embroidery. From above I wore a net dress. It is one of the cases where comfort for me was primary importance, and my choices were determined by that.
